Interactive Virtual Games
Interactive games are a great way to get your team engaged and having fun together. Here are two popular options to consider:

Online Escape Rooms
Escape rooms have been a popular team-building activity for years, and they've made a smooth transition to the virtual world. Platforms like The Escape Game and Escape Room in a Box offer immersive, interactive experiences that your team can enjoy together. These games encourage communication, problem-solving, and collaboration, making them perfect for remote teams.

To make the most of this activity, ensure you book a time slot that works for everyone and provide clear instructions on how to access the game. You might also want to consider sending small prizes or gifts to the winning team members to make the experience even more memorable.
Virtual Game Shows
Who doesn't love a good game show? Platforms like Kahoot! and Jackbox Games offer a variety of interactive, multiplayer games that your team can enjoy together. From trivia and word games to drawing and guessing challenges, there's something for everyone. These games are easy to set up and can be played using a web browser or a mobile app.

To create a more engaging experience, consider hosting a themed game show, such as a Christmas-themed quiz or a holiday-themed version of a popular game show. You can also encourage team members to dress up in their favorite holiday outfits to get everyone in the spirit.
Collaborative Virtual Activities
Collaborative activities are another excellent way to bring your team together and foster a sense of camaraderie. Here are two ideas to consider:

Virtual Cooking or Baking Classes
What better way to get your team in the holiday spirit than by cooking or baking together? Platforms like MasterClass and Sur La Table offer virtual cooking and baking classes that your team can enjoy together. These classes are led by professional chefs and instructors and provide a fun, interactive experience that everyone can participate in.




















To make the most of this activity, choose a recipe that's easy to follow and provides enough time for everyone to participate. You might also want to consider sending ingredients or a gift card to each team member so they can cook or bake along at home.
Virtual Holiday Craft Workshops
Getting crafty is a fun and creative way to spend time together during the holidays. Platforms like Paint Nite and Board & Brush offer virtual craft workshops that your team can enjoy together. These workshops are led by professional instructors and provide a fun, hands-on experience that everyone can participate in.
To make the most of this activity, choose a craft that's easy to follow and provides enough time for everyone to complete their project. You might also want to consider sending any necessary supplies to each team member so they can create their masterpiece at home.
